LASU Sacks Two Lecturers Over Allegations Of Sexual Misconduct, Inhumane Treatment, Graft

LASU dismisses dreaded Prof Olatunji Abanikannda and Dr Khadejah Kareem – Ibraheem

Following multiple complaints of inhumane treatment from students and staff, Lagos State University (LASU), has officially dismissed two senior lecturers, including Prof. Olatunji Abanikanda, following allegations of sexual harassment, inhumane treatment, and financial misconduct.

Prof Abanikanda

At a council meeting on July 3, 2025, it was determined that Prof. Abanikanda forced students to work up to 16 hours daily without breaks or essentials—even during heavy rain—and subjected female students to harassment.

In addition, allegations include threats, abusive language, unauthorized money collection, and misuse of funds from farm produce (over ₦10.6 million) by a second dismissed lecturer, Dr. Khadeejah Kareem-Ibraheem.

LASU in its statement affirmed its commitment to restoring integrity and safety within its academic environment.
